Advertisement

单片机应用程序开发库-物联网竞赛版.rar

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源为《单片机应用程序开发库-物联网竞赛版》压缩包,包含针对物联网竞赛优化的单片机程序代码和开发文档,适用于学习与参赛。 这段文字描述了一个包含物联网竞赛相关技术的资源包,其中包括ZigBee、LoRa、NB-IOT以及Android开发库,并且提供了相应的开发手册与SDK接口文档。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• -.rar
    优质
    本资源为《单片机应用程序开发库-物联网竞赛版》压缩包,包含针对物联网竞赛优化的单片机程序代码和开发文档,适用于学习与参赛。 这段文字描述了一个包含物联网竞赛相关技术的资源包,其中包括ZigBee、LoRa、NB-IOT以及Android开发库,并且提供了相应的开发手册与SDK接口文档。
  • 优质
    物联网竞赛旨在激发创新思维和实践能力,参赛者通过设计开发基于物联网技术的应用或系统,解决实际问题,促进科技与生活的深度融合。 这是我们参加物联网比赛的一个产品创意文档,仅供大家参考。
  • 技术题(GZ-2022034).zip
    优质
    这份名为GZ-2022034的压缩文件包含了关于物联网技术应用的相关竞赛题目,旨在考察参赛者在物联网领域的实践能力和创新思维。 GZ-2022034 物联网技术应用赛项赛题.zip
  • 移动互.rar
    优质
    本资源为《移动互联网应用程序开发》课程资料,涵盖Android和iOS应用开发技术、用户体验设计及最新行业趋势分析等内容。 01试题库 02.系统模块设计说明书模板 03.辅助资料 04.服务器接口以及war包上传 其他移动互联网应用软件开发的相关资料请参见我发布的其它帖子。
  • 中移CM32M101A文档
    优质
    本文档为中移物联网专为CM32M101A系列单片机构建,详尽涵盖了硬件特性、编程指南及应用实例等内容,旨在助力开发者高效开展基于该芯片的项目研发。 国产水表无磁计量单片机包含数据手册、用户手册;Keil的pack包;芯片外设全部例程;方案板硬件资料及使用手册;下载工具及其使用手册。这套开发资源涵盖了该芯片软件与硬件开发所需的全套基础资料。
  • 的参作品RAR文件
    优质
    该RAR文件包含一个参加物联网竞赛的作品,内含项目文档、源代码及设计图等资料,详细展示了创新性的技术应用与解决方案。 标题中的“我的参赛作品.rar,物联网竞赛”表明这是一个与物联网技术相关的参赛项目,可能包含了项目的详细设计、源代码等核心内容。在这个项目中,我们可以深入探讨物联网的基本概念、技术架构以及在实际应用中的体现。 物联网(Internet of Things,IoT)是信息技术领域的一个重要分支,它是指通过网络将各种物理设备、传感器、执行器等连接起来,实现物与物、物与人的广泛交互。物联网的核心特征在于数据采集、传输、处理和应用,它将数字世界和物理世界深度融合,极大地扩展了互联网的应用范围。 在“设计报告_组长_杨瑞璋.docx”这个文件中,我们可能会看到项目的整体设计方案。这通常包括项目背景、目标、系统架构、功能模块、硬件选型、软件设计、数据处理流程、安全性和隐私保护策略等方面。设计报告会详述物联网系统的各个组成部分,如感知层(传感器、RFID等)、网络层(WiFi、蓝牙、LoRa等通信技术)、平台层(云计算或边缘计算)以及应用层(用户界面、数据分析应用)。 源代码文件则包含实现物联网功能的具体编程语言,如C++、Python、Java等。这些代码可能涉及传感器数据的读取、网络通信协议的实现、云平台的数据交互以及用户界面的控制逻辑。开发者可能使用MQTT、CoAP等物联网协议进行设备间通信,或者使用Apache Kafka、MongoDB等工具进行大数据处理。 物联网竞赛的项目往往要求创新性和实用性并重,参赛者需要利用现有的物联网技术解决实际问题或提供新的解决方案。通过分析数据,优化算法,提升系统的效率和用户体验是这类项目中常见的挑战。 在“源代码”部分,我们可以看到参赛团队是如何将理论转化为实际操作的。这包括如何编写代码来控制硬件设备、实现数据的实时传输和存储以及对收集到的数据进行有效分析和呈现。这部分内容展示了参赛者的编程能力和问题解决能力。 这个压缩包文件可能涵盖了物联网技术的多个方面,包括硬件设计、软件开发、数据处理和系统集成。通过对这些内容的学习和研究,我们可以深化对物联网的理解,并为今后的项目开发提供参考和灵感。
  • HBuilder的华为云
    优质
    本应用由HBuilder开发平台构建,专为华为云物联网服务设计,旨在提供高效、稳定的设备连接与数据处理解决方案。 Hbulider制作的华为云物联网APP展示了使用华为云平台与MQTT协议构建物联网应用的实际操作。该应用程序旨在接收硬件设备通过MQTT协议上传的数据,并基于这些数据在用户界面上提供丰富的可视化体验。 以下是关键知识点: 1. **MQTT**:MQTT(Message Queuing Telemetry Transport)是一种轻量级的消息传输协议,常用于物联网(IoT)设备之间的通信。它支持低带宽、高延迟或不可靠的网络环境,并适合在传感器和移动设备之间传输数据。 2. **华为云平台**:华为云提供了全面的云计算服务,包括计算、存储和数据库等资源,为开发者提供了一个便捷的开发和部署物联网应用的平台。在这个案例中,它被用作处理和储存数据的核心部分。 3. **电子围栏**:这是一种地理围栏技术,允许应用程序根据设备上传的位置信息(经纬度)创建虚拟边界。当设备进入或离开特定区域时,系统可以触发相应的通知或动作,提高了监控与管理的效率。 4. **自定义静态数据显示**:在地图界面上显示温度、速度等自定义静态数据的能力表明开发者使用了地图API来集成硬件数据,使用户能够在地图上直观地看到设备的状态信息。 5. **页面布局与交互设计**:文件名如`index.html`, `main.js`, `App.vue`暗示该项目采用了Vue.js框架。其中,`index.html`通常是应用的主入口文件;`main.js`用于初始化和配置应用;而`App.vue`是应用程序的主要组件,定义了整体布局及用户交互。 6. **uni-app**:使用如`uni.promisify.adaptor.js`, `pages.json`, 和 `uni.scss`等文件表明该项目可能采用了uni-app框架。这是一个跨平台开发工具包,允许开发者一次性编写代码后在微信小程序、支付宝小程序、H5和App等多种平台上运行应用。 7. **配置文件**:项目中包含的`manifest.json`和`package.json`是重要的配置文件。“manifest.json”定义了应用程序在不同平台上的显示与行为规则;而“package.json”则记录了项目的依赖项及元信息。 此项目展示了物联网硬件设备如何连接至云端,并通过MQTT协议传输数据,利用华为云作为处理中心。同时结合电子围栏技术实现地理空间管理,并采用Vue.js和uni-app进行前端应用开发,提供了丰富的用户界面与交互功能。掌握这些关键技术后,开发者可以构建类似的应用程序以高效管理和可视化物联网数据。
  • AIOT在中的使
    优质
    本教程旨在为参加物联网竞赛的学生和爱好者提供AIOT技术的应用指导,涵盖从基础概念到实践操作的全面讲解,助力参赛者设计创新解决方案。 本段落介绍了如何在虚拟仿真环境中搭建一套 LoRaWAN 系统,并以下载并启动 Chirpstack 为例,详细讲解了在实验平台中打开虚拟机终端、输入命令来下载和解压 Chirpstack 的步骤。该教程适用于物联网竞赛-AIoT的使用。
  • 2021年嵌入式技术.rar
    优质
    《2021年嵌入式技术应用开发竞赛题库》汇集了该年度内针对嵌入式系统开发的关键挑战和创新实践,旨在为参赛者提供全面的练习与参考资源。 2021年嵌入式技术应用开发赛项包含10套国赛题库,分为三个模块。
  • 文档(软件大
    优质
    本手册专为参加软件大赛的学生设计,详尽介绍了物联网项目开发所需的基础知识、技术框架和实战案例,旨在帮助参赛者更好地理解和应用物联网技术。 在“软件大赛物联网开发文档”这个项目中,我们可以探索物联网技术的多个方面及其在整个软件开发过程中的重要性。物联网(Internet of Things,IoT)是现代科技领域的一个核心部分,它涉及到物理世界中的设备、传感器、网络通信以及数据分析,以实现智能互联。 一流的软件架构与设计是物联网应用的基础。这包括选择合适的硬件平台,如微控制器或边缘计算设备,并搭建高效能、可扩展的网络架构。物联网系统通常需要处理大量实时数据,因此高效的通信协议(例如MQTT、CoAP和LoRaWAN)在设计中起着关键作用。同时考虑到设备资源限制,软件架构应采用轻量级操作系统和优化编程语言,如FreeRTOS与MicroPython。 文档在这个过程中扮演着至关重要的角色。详尽的文档能够帮助团队理解项目的整体结构、功能需求、设计决策以及实现细节,从而提高开发效率和协作效果。例如,需求规格书应清晰地定义系统功能和性能指标;设计文档则涵盖硬件接口、软件架构及模块间交互;操作手册方便用户与维护人员进行设备部署和故障排查。此外,代码注释与开发日志也是必不可少的,它们有助于后期的代码维护和升级。 描述中提到这是一个获得三等奖的作品,这可能意味着尽管文档质量稍逊于软件架构和设计,但整体项目仍然达到了一定的技术水平。在实际开发过程中不断改进文档质量使之与优秀的设计相匹配可以提升项目的专业性和竞争力。 压缩包内的“物联网文档”中我们可以期待找到关于物联网系统的各种文档如需求分析报告、系统设计图、网络拓扑结构、设备配置指南、API接口说明及测试报告等。这些文档将为开发者提供深入理解项目的技术细节和实施步骤,帮助他们更好地参与到物联网解决方案的构建中。 物联网开发是一个复杂且多元化的领域涵盖了硬件选型、网络设计、软件架构以及安全策略等多个环节。而良好的文档是确保项目成功的关键因素之一它不仅促进了团队间的沟通还确保了软件的可维护性和可扩展性。对于这个获得三等奖的物联网项目我们可以从中学习到如何平衡技术实现与文档质量以达到更高级别的项目成果。